Introduction

I have worked as a window technician for the last five years. Prior to that, I worked as a carpenter and did general construction work (eleven years). I am a licensed and bonded general contractor and have experience with nearly all aspects of residential construction, from breaking ground, foundations, finish carpentry, painting, and everything in between .Window repairs are very expensive, but I am willing and able to offer my services at a reasonable price, I also offer a variety of discounts. I encourage potential customers to do their research prior to having their windows replaced or repaired. I can and will refer potential customers to other window specialists if I am not the best man for the job. I am a small town, family man, having grown up in Buckley, WA. I love being able to help others in my community at a fair price. I would love to meet with you and see how I can help you.

What advice would you give a customer looking to hire a provider in your area of work?

unfold fold
take pictures. if you are the original home owner your windows may be covered under a warranty.
